static int coroutine_fn nbd_co_send_structured_error(NBDClient *client,
                                                     uint64_t handle,
                                                     uint32_t error,
                                                     const char *msg,
                                                     Error **errp)
{
    NBDStructuredError chunk;
    int nbd_err = system_errno_to_nbd_errno(error);
    struct iovec iov[] = {
        {.iov_base = &chunk, .iov_len = sizeof(chunk)},
        {.iov_base = (char *)msg, .iov_len = msg ? strlen(msg) : 0},
    };

    assert(nbd_err);
    trace_nbd_co_send_structured_error(handle, nbd_err,
                                       nbd_err_lookup(nbd_err), msg ? msg : "");
    set_be_chunk(&chunk.h, NBD_REPLY_FLAG_DONE, NBD_REPLY_TYPE_ERROR, handle,
                 sizeof(chunk) - sizeof(chunk.h) + iov[1].iov_len);
    stl_be_p(&chunk.error, nbd_err);
    stw_be_p(&chunk.message_length, iov[1].iov_len);

    return nbd_co_send_iov(client, iov, 1 + !!iov[1].iov_len, errp);
}
